The Microsoft Office Removal Tool for Windows 10 is an essential utility for users who need to perform a clean uninstallation of the Office suite. Whether you are dealing with a corrupted installation, upgrading to a newer version, or simply troubleshooting persistent errors, this tool ensures that every trace of the software is removed from your system. Standard uninstallation through the Windows Control Panel often leaves behind residual files and registry keys that can interfere with future installations. To use the tool on Windows 10, you first need to download the SetupProd_OffScrub.exe file from the official Microsoft support website. Once launched, the application performs a system scan to detect all installed versions of Office, including Office 365, Office 2019, and Office 2016. Users can then select the specific version they wish to remove. The process is largely hands-off, though a system restart is usually required to finalize the deletion of files that were in use during the scan.
